What is the evidence that supports the autogenic hypothesis?

Biology
1 answer:
disa [49]3 years ago
8 0

Answer:

Explanation:

The hypothesis is supported by the studies on mitochondria. The mitochondria contains its own DNA and sythesizes many of its RNA and proteins. The mitochondrial protein synthesis machine, the ribosomes are similar to those found in bacteria. Similar to the bacterial cells, the mitochondria also contain circular genome
